P. Perzyna is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Materials Chemistry and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, P. Perzyna has authored 53 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 39 papers in Mechanics of Materials, 37 papers in Materials Chemistry and 15 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in P. Perzyna’s work include High-Velocity Impact and Material Behavior (31 papers), Material Properties and Failure Mechanisms (13 papers) and Geotechnical and Geomechanical Engineering (10 papers). P. Perzyna is often cited by papers focused on High-Velocity Impact and Material Behavior (31 papers), Material Properties and Failure Mechanisms (13 papers) and Geotechnical and Geomechanical Engineering (10 papers). P. Perzyna collaborates with scholars based in Poland, United States and Germany. P. Perzyna's co-authors include Tomasz Łodygowski, A. Sawczuk, R.B. Pęcherski, Wojciech Sumelka, Pawel Woelke, George Z. Voyiadjis, E. Stein, William O. Williams, G. Lebon and Teresa Frąś and has published in prestigious journals such as Computer Methods in Applied Mechanics and Engineering, Journal of Applied Mechanics and International Journal for Numerical Methods in Engineering.
